Community Input Meetings: Future of Dolan Center and Fairbanks Park

The Town of Dedham Parks & Recreation Department invites you to attend two important community input meetings to help shape the future of our local facilities and parks.

Meeting 1: Dolan Center Future Planning

Time: 6:30 PM

Location: Parks and Recreation Offices (former Capen School) Multi-Purpose Room at 310 Sprague Street

Now that the Parks and Recreation Department has relocated to its new space, the Town is beginning a planning process to determine the best possible reuse of the Dolan Center and surrounding outdoor areas. This is a unique opportunity to shape how this facility can continue to serve Dedham residents for years to come.

Our consultant, Activitas, will present some initial ideas and concepts for potential reuse. The Town is eager to hear your feedback, suggestions, and priorities to ensure that any future plans reflect the community’s needs and values.

Meeting 2: Discuss the future of Fairbanks Park

Time: 7:30 PM

Location: Parks and Recreation Offices (former Capen School) Multi-Purpose Room at 310 Sprague Street

The Town has engaged the consulting firm Activitas to study ways to renovate and reconfigure Fairbanks Park. Currently, the park includes three baseball fields and one soccer field. Activitas will present possible proposals for new layouts and improvements that aim to better serve Dedham’s youth sports groups and the broader community.
